Transport convention hits the gas in Wuhan
More than 4,000 experts in transportation from China and abroad gathered in central China to discuss sustainable development in the field on Wednesday.
Titled "Innovation, Low Carbon, Wisdom, Sharing", the four-day World Transport Convention kicked off in Wuhan, capital of Hubei province.
More than 230 forums with different themes will be held.
The event will demonstrate scientific and technological achievements and development models in the fields of sustainable transportation, green transportation, smart transportation, digital transportation, comprehensive transportation and intelligent transportation, as well as the integration of transportation and energy.
Thanks to major projects such as the Hong Kong-Zhuhai-Macao Bridge, CCCC has overcome a series of world-class technical problems, formulated a series of international and domestic industry standards and trained a large number of top professional and technical personnel in the industry, said Wang Haihuai, general manager of China Communications.
He also noted the company will enhance international exchanges and cooperation.
